Mayo
General Hospital
Rapid Progress on Phase
II
The site works on Phase II of the
new hospital are progressing to timetable. The Maternity floor is
taking shape, and the new Accident and Emergency Department is also
appearing. The lower picture was taken on
17/10/99.


The Minister for Health, Mr. Brian
Cowan TD turned the sod on the development on Friday 22nd. January.
New ward areas will be constructed
with the provision of an Orthopaedic Unit, a Geriatric Unit, a new
Maternity Unit and Labour Ward, a new Gynaecology Ward, and a
Psychiatric Unit.
These will bring the bed compliment
up to 240 beds. The Phase Two major development also includes the
construction of Ancillary Departments i.e. Accident and Emergency
Department, Laboratory etc.
It is anticipated that Stage 1 of
the building will be fitted out and ready to go into service in
March-April 2000. Large areas of the old building will then be
cleared for redevelopment for their planned new functions in Stage 2
of the development.
